TimeValue Software™ TValue™ amortization software version 5.1 runs more efficiently in the latest Windows operating systems and includes a number of new and improved features to make your job easier.
Here are just a few of the improvements:
- Fully compatible with Windows 7, Windows Vista, and Windows Server 2008 for a seamless transition.
- Ability to enter up to 3,999 events per cash flow line for even more options when structuring loans or investments for practically any situation with prolonged time periods.
- Input and calculate larger currency amounts up to 1 trillion dollars.
- View balloon help references that assist with tips on how to input data in a given field.
- Display and print expanded amortization schedules to support greater levels of detail on reports requiring over 15,000 lines of information over longer periods of time
- Create larger custom event names of up to 30 characters for more detailed descriptions on schedules
- Display prepaid interest to three digits for additional accuracy and more exact APR calculations

TimeValue Software™ Tax941™ software version 2010.3 is currently being shipped to customers. This version includes the new Form 941 that addresses the qualified employer’s social security tax credit for the period of March 18 to March 31, 2010. It also takes into account the employer’s social security tax exemption for the period after March 31, 2010, and before January 1, 2011. Rates are updated for the third quarter 2010.
